The BCCI, on Thursday, announced the India A, India B and India C teams for the Deodhar Trophy starting from October 23 in New Delhi.
Wicketkeeper-batsman Dinesh Karthik will lead the India A side while Shreyas Iyer and Ajinkya Rahane have been named India B and C skippers respectively.
With the senior selection committee, headed by MSK Prasad, declaring the Indian team only for the first two ODIs against West Indies, the likes of Karthik, Mayank Agarwal and Washington Sundar will be keen on hedging their bets.
Meanwhile, all-rounders Hardik Pandya and Kedar Jadhav have been left out of the tournament as they continue to recover from their respective injuries.
With the 2019 World Cup just eight months away, India is still searching for a perfect middle order combination. However, Prasad had earlier assured that the think-tank 'was close' to finding the right candidates.
Squads for the tournament as mentioned below:-
India A: Dinesh Karthik (C & WK), Prithvi Shaw, Anmolpreet Singh, A R Easwaran, Ankit Bawne, Nitish Rana, Karun Nair, Krunal Pandya, R Ashwin, Shreyas Gopal, S Mulani, Mohammed Siraj, Dhawal Kulkarni, Siddarth Kaul
India B: Shreyas Iyer (C), Mayank Agarwal, Rituraj Gaekwad, PS Chopra, Hanuma Vihari, Manoj Tiwary, Ankush Bains (WK), Rohit Rayudu, K Gowtham, Mayank Markande, S Nadeem, Deepak Chahar, Varun Aaron, Jaydev Unadkat
India C: Ajinkya Rahane (C), Abhinav Mukund, Shubman Gill, R Samarth, Suresh Raina, Suryakumar Yadav, Ishan Kishan (WK), Vijay Shankar, Washington Sundar, Rahul Chahar, Pappu Roy, Navdeep Saini, R Gurbani, Umar Nazir
